A message screen appears, telling you whether the system passed
each test. If your system fails a test, run the system test several
times before concluding that there is a problem. Occasional
fluctuations in the phone line or satellite signal can give
temporary false readings.
New Access Card Periodically, your program provider may issue
you a replacement access card. The New Access Card Setup
display screen allows you to transfer the information from the
old card onto the new one.
Follow the display screen prompts to initialize your new card.
Once you have transferred the information to the new card, your
old card becomes invalid.

1. Use the arrows or digit keys to input the correct code for
your VCR brand. The VCR codes are located in the Reference
section.
2. Follow the on-screen instructions to ensure that you are
using the correct code. If the VCR automatically stops tape
play, then you know that the receiver and the VCR are
communicating.
